McCain Just Had His “Mission Accomplished” Moment

Posted in: 2008 Election, Iraq, St. John McCain

St. McCain, last April:

Many in Washington have called for an end to our involvement in Iraq, yet they offer no opinion about the consequences of this course of action, beyond a vague assurance that all will be well if the Iraqis are left to work out their differences themselves.

St. McCain, yesterday:

My friends, the war will be over soon — although the insurgency will go on for years and years and years. But it’ll be handled by the Iraqis not by us.
